Jeff Detwiler
Long & Foster

Jeff Detwiler is the president and chief executive officer of The Long & Foster Companies. In this capacity, he focuses on guiding the strategic direction of the organization, including the operations of its seven business lines: real estate, property management, mortgage, settlement services, insurance, corporate real estate services, and new development real estate sales and marketing. In addition to these businesses, he oversees six enterprise functions: human resources, legal, marketing, information services, finance and facilities. The Long & Foster Companies operate in seven states across the Mid-Atlantic and Northeast regions and the District of Columbia. It has more than 230 locations, 1,800 employees and 11,000 real estate agents. Detwiler has nearly 30 years of experience in the financial services field, which includes mortgage banking, fixed income trading and traditional banking. He graduated from Princeton in 1983. Detwiler was recognized again in 2018 as one of the most powerful and influential people in residential real estate, according to the Swanepoel Power 200. He currently serves on the following boards: Economic Alliance of Greater Baltimore, Board of Directors; Greater Washington Board of Trade, Board of Directors and Executive Committee; George Mason University, Board of Trustees and Real Estate Committee; Long & Foster Companies, Board of Directors; M & T Bank, Baltimore Advisory Board; Moxi Works, Board of Directors and UpStreamRE, LLC, Board of Managers.
